Omori & Holthuis (2005)

Omori, M., and L.B. Holthuis (2005) Crustaceans on postage stamps from 1870 to and including 2002: Revised article for our paper in 2000 and addendum. Journal of the Tokyo University of Marine Science and Technology 1:1–39.

Names Appearing in this Publication

Data not yet available.